Therapy is best practiced when learning is carried on in day-to-day life. When children are at home, they will be more comfortable practicing the skills. Continuity of the treatment sessions at home also contributes to the move. Confidence is also created by a supportive home, and stress is minimized, which makes learning and growing easier for the children.
